1

我在 mysql 中存储了一些带有 html 代码的记录,它也存储它们,但是当我想更改它们时,它会强制我进入数据库然后更改,但我希望我创建一个可以浏览 html 页面的 php 文件存储在 mysql 中,现在我有更新功能,但是当我更改一些文本或添加一些东西时

它显示错误“您的 SQL 语法有错误;请检查与您的 MySQL 服务器版本相对应的手册,以在第 1 行的 '= '' WHERE BookId = '25'' 附近使用正确的语法”

这是我的代码:

mysql_query("UPDATE inhweb SET homepage ='$homepage', services = '$services', departments = '$departments', $contacts = '$contacts' WHERE BookId = '$id'")
            or die(mysql_error());
4

2 回答 2

2

尝试这个:

mysql_query("UPDATE inhweb SET homepage ='$homepage', services = '$services', departments = '$departments', contacts = '$contacts' WHERE BookId = '$id'")
        or die(mysql_error());

我不认为你的 MySQLcontacts列名应该在$那里。

于 2012-11-27T09:25:11.083 回答
1

您的查询中有一个$符号和您的字段名称contacts$contacts ='$contacts'

于 2012-11-27T09:26:43.093 回答